    Abstract: A process for the thermal treatment of wrought products made of an aluminum alloy of the 2000 series comprising by weight from 3.5 to 5% copper, from 0.2 to 1% magnesium, from 0.25 to 1.2% silicon, with a Si to Mg ratio greater than 0.8 comprising solution heat treatment, quenching treatment, ageing and tempering wherein the tempering treatment comprises at least two stages: (1) a main tempering treatment at a temperature higher than 225.degree. C. and lower than 280.degree. C. lasting between 6 seconds and 60 minutes and (2) a complementary tempering treatment at a temperature between 120.degree. and 175.degree. C. lasting between 4 and 192 hours. This process allows the compromise between the mechanical tensile characteristics and the resistance to intercrystalline and stress corrosion to be improved.

    Abstract: A method for the production of a composite hollow body formed of aluminum alloys and composed of two layers having differing structure. One layer of the hollow body is intended to operate in contact with a mobile surface and is produced by extruding a mixture of particles of a hypereutectic silicon alloy having fine grains and an addition product. The other layer is selected from among alloys having certain particular properties and has the structure of a cast and wrought product. The present method particularly consists of the step of joining the two layers by coextrusion on a mandrel in an inverse extrusion press. The composite hollow bodies so produced are used in the production of linings for internal combustion engines or for jacks.

    Abstract: A process for the spark erosion machining of a workpiece having a cylindrical orifice, formed of any desired cross-section, the invention utilizes an electrode which is moved relative to the workpiece. According to the invention, a first rapid rough shaping pass is performed by descent of the electrode parallel to the generatrices of the orifice. On raising, the electrode is then translated perpendicularly to the generatrices by a distance r and then is lowered at a slower speed and is raised again before performing a circular translation of radius r. The electrode is again lowered and raised, and the operation is repeated n times so as to perform a complete revolution. The present process allows efficient machining of dies for metal extrusion.

    Abstract: The invention relates to a process for the thermal treatment of aluminum alloys containing zinc, magnesium and copper as main alloying elements, and the products manufactured by this process and having an average particle diameter of Al-Mg-Cr phase of between 800 A and 1000 A. This process involves carrying out a treatment at high temperature for a sufficiently short period to prevent coalescense into particles which are too large. This treatment is preferably carried out at the homogenization stage for thin products and at the final dissolution stage for thick products. The invention is applied, in particular, to the manufacture of thin or thick sheets for the aeronautical industry.

    Abstract: A process for the thermal treatment of thin products made of 7000 series aluminum alloys comprising a solution heat treatment, quenching treatment and a tempering treatment in three stages:pretempering between 100.degree. and 150.degree. C. for 5 minutes to 24 hours;intermediate tempering; and,final tempering between 100.degree. and 160.degree. C. for 2 to 48 hours.Intermediate tempering comprises a rapid rise in temperature to 190.degree. C. followed by a treatment at a temperature .theta.(t) between 190.degree. and 250.degree. C. for a total duration T in such a way that the function: ##EQU1## is comprised between 0.5 and 1.5; and T and t being expressed in seconds and .theta.(t) in .degree.K.This tempering treatment imparts to the products treated both high mechanical characteristics and a high resistance to stress corrosion.

    Abstract: A compressor for a refrigerant gas wherein a rotor acts on a rocking plate to effect rocking thereof and reciprocation of pistons in cylinder bores to produce suction and exhaust strokes for refrigerant gas. A lubricant is contained in a sump in the compressor casing and it is atomized and mixed with refrigerant gas which leaks past the pistons. A duct is formed in the casing for conveying the mixture of refrigerant gas and lubricant from the casing under the action of the suction stroke of the pistons. The mixture is delivered at the inlet for refrigerant gas and the total mixture now flows to a separator where the lubricant is separated from the refrigerant gas. The refrigerant gas is then supplied into the cylinder bores during the suction stroke and the lubricant is delivered into a reservoir where it is forceably delivered back into the casing to the sump.

    Abstract: This heating apparatus includes an air flow chamber having outer and inner, generally cylindrical and parallel walls within which a combustion chamber is nested. The combustion chamber includes means for burning a fuel and has outer and inner parallel, generally cylindrical heat conducting walls. It is coupled to an exhaust duct which has at least a portion thereof surrounded by the inner wall of the air flow chamber. In one form air is driven by an electric fan through the air flow chamber around the combustion chamber and out to a distribution duct. The fan also blows air into the combustion chamber for combustion of the fuel. In another form, a fan is driven by th combustion exhaust gases thereby propelling air through the air flow chamber and into the combustion chamber via a compressor wheel. Other forms include heat-conductive members placed into contact with the exhaust duct or with the air chamber to further heat the air before it enters the distribution duct.

    Abstract: Drawn and hemmed metal parts, such as vehicle body panels, are made from an aluminum based alloy containing 1.5-2.5% copper, 0.5-1.0% magnesium and 0.4-0.8% silicon and in addition may contain up to 0.2% chromium, 0.4% manganese, 0.2% titanium, 0.2% zirconium and 0.5% iron.
